前页 后页

技术开发人员

技术开发是Enterprise Architect谁创建自定义的补充内已经存在的功能,用户Enterprise Architect 。

添加的内容包括UML配置文件,模式,代码模板,标记的值类型,脚本,自定义查询,转换,MDG技术和Enterprise Architect Add-Ins 。通过创建这些扩展,技术开发人员可以针对特定任务自定义Enterprise Architect建模过程,并加快开发速度。

开发技术

延期

详情

也可以看看

UML配置文件

通过创建UML概要文件,您可以创建自定义扩展来构建特定于特定域的UML模型。

概要文件存储为XML文件,可以根据需要导入到任何模型中。

使用UML配置文件

模式

模式是协作对象和类的集合,它们为可重复的建模问题解决方案提供了通用模板。

由于在任何新项目中都发现了模式,因此您可以发布基本的模式模板。

可以重复使用模式,并为将来的任何项目修改适当的变量名。

设计模式

代码模板

代码模板用于自定义Enterprise Architect生成的源代码的输出;通过这种方式,您可以生成Enterprise Architect未特别支持的代码语言,并定义系统如何生成源代码以符合您自己的公司样式准则。

代码模板框架

标记值类型

除了UML语言直接支持的信息之外, Enterprise Architect还使用标记值来扩展与元素有关的信息。

严格来说,标记值是建模项目的属性值,该属性称为标签;例如:一个名为Person的Class元素可能具有一个名为'Age'的标签,且其Tagged值为'42'。

更宽松地说,标记和值的组合可以称为标记值。

标记值类型是一组参数,它们定义和/或限制标签的可能值,以及在许多情况下,如何将特定值分配给标签;例如,标签“年龄”的标签值类型可能为“整数”,因此用户只需键入数字值即可。

或者,类型可以是“旋转”,下限和上限分别为20和120,因此用户可以通过单击字段中的箭头来设置值,以在20和120的范围内递增或递减该值。

通常,标记值在代码生成过程中或由其他工具使用,以传递用于以特定方式对元素进行操作的信息。

标记值 标记值类型

MDG技术

MDG Technologies可用于创建资源的逻辑集合,这些资源可包含可通过技术文件访问的UML概要文件,模式,代码模板,图像文件和标记值类型。

MDG技术

Enterprise Architect Add-Ins

使用Add-Ins您可以在Enterprise Architect构建自己的功能,创建可以扩展系统功能的微型程序,定义自己的菜单,以及创建自己的自定义视图。

Enterprise Architect Add-In模型

学到更多